Original Description
Francesco Guardi’s View of the Piazzetta, Looking Towards San Giorgio Maggiore, Venice is a luminous masterpiece of 18th-century Venetian veduta painting that captures the ephemeral charm of Venice with poetic spontaneity. The scene unfolds at the Piazzetta San Marco, where the iconic columns of St. Mark and St. Theodore frame a shimmering expanse of the lagoon, leading the eye toward the majestic silhouette of San Giorgio Maggiore in the distance. Guardi’s loose, shimmering brushwork and delicate play of light evoke the atmospheric vibrancy of the city, blending realism with a dreamlike quality. Unlike the precise architectural detail of Canaletto, Guardi’s style embraces a more impressionistic approach, infusing the scene with movement and a sense of transience—an homage to Venice’s fading grandeur during the twilight of the Republic. This work exemplifies the capriccio tradition, where real and imagined elements coalesce, securing Guardi’s place as a bridge between the Rococo and early Romanticism in art history.
